Jammu and Kashmir: DC Reasi flags off Fit India Freedom Run

Srinagar:  Deputy Commissioner Reasi, Indu Kanwal Chib, in presence of Senior Superintendent of Police, Rashmi Wazir and DYSSO, Subash Chander on Tuesday flagged off Fit India Freedom Run here from the premises of the DDC office complex.

The freedom run culminated at sports stadium.

The event was organised by the department of Youth Services and Sports.

The girl students from GHSS Reasi and all the staff members of the district administration participated in the event.

The DC, while speaking on the occasion, said that it is a very good step to revive our daily physical fitness programs which were deferred due to COVID19. She said that main aim of organizing such events is to engage youth in sports activities to keep them physically and mentally fit.

She advised the youth to actively participate in sports and spread message of fitness in society.

The DC also highlighted the initiatives taken by district administration to give flip to sports activities in the district and said that besides developing play grounds, sports equipment will also be provided to all Panchayats of the district for which Rs 20,000 has been earmarked for each Panchayat.
